Joshua 4:14
Good News Translation
What the LORD did that day made the people of Israel consider Joshua a great man. They honored him all his life, just as they had honored Moses.

New Revised Standard Version
On that day the LORD exalted Joshua in the sight of all Israel; and they stood in awe of him, as they had stood in awe of Moses, all the days of his life.

New American Bible
That day the LORD exalted Joshua in the sight of all Israel, and so during his whole life they feared him as they had feared Moses.

Douay-Rheims Bible
In that day the Lord magnified Joshua in the sight of all Israel, that they should fear him, as they had feared Moses, while he lived.
